Abstract
Sheets of microporous polyurethane material are dyed by immersing them in an aqueous dye solution at pH 3-9 containing a water-soluble anionic dye containing at least one water-solubilising group linked below with an empirical figure related to its water-solubilising power: -SO3- <FORM:1034558/D1-D2/1> -OH (0.25), -NH2 (0.25), -NH- (0.25), -OCH3 (0.25), -NH-CO-NH- (0.25), -SO2NH- (0.25), -SO2- (0.25) and -CONH- (0.25), the dye having an "equivalent weight" (its molecular weight divided by the sum of the solubilising values above) of 200-600, the dyed material being then masked in water and dried. The dyes are preferably anionic azo or anthraquinone dyes having an "equivalent weight" of 250-500. The process may be carried out by using a dyebath at 75-100 DEG C. initially at pH 7 and reducing to pH 5 by adding acetic, formic or citric acid. The microporous sheets may contain a porous fibrous substrate of many specified types especially polyethylene terephthalate fibre and the polyurethane may contain up to 50% of polyvinyl chloride. The dyed materials may be after-chromed to improve the fastness. Examples are given.
